大数据分析需要哪些知识
-
大数据分析是一门涉及多方面知识的领域,需要掌握多种技能和工具才能进行有效的数据分析。以下是进行大数据分析所需的一些主要知识:
-
数据处理与清洗:大数据分析的第一步是数据的处理与清洗,这包括数据收集、数据清洗、数据转换和数据集成等过程。数据处理与清洗的目的是将原始数据转化为可供分析使用的格式,去除数据中的噪声和无效信息,确保数据的准确性和完整性。
-
数据挖掘与统计分析:数据挖掘是大数据分析的核心环节之一,通过数据挖掘技术可以发现数据中隐藏的模式、关联规则和趋势等信息。统计分析则可以帮助分析师理解数据的分布、趋势和相关性,从而得出有效的结论和决策。
-
机器学习与人工智能:机器学习和人工智能是大数据分析中的重要技术手段,通过这些技术可以构建预测模型、分类模型和聚类模型等,从而实现对数据的自动化分析和挖掘。了解机器学习和人工智能的原理和应用场景对于进行大数据分析至关重要。
-
数据可视化与报告:数据可视化是将数据转化为图表、图形和可视化界面的过程,通过数据可视化可以更直观地呈现数据的特征和规律。同时,撰写数据分析报告也是大数据分析的重要环节,可以帮助他人理解数据分析的过程和结果,从而做出相应的决策。
-
大数据技术与工具:进行大数据分析需要掌握一些大数据技术和工具,如Hadoop、Spark、SQL、Python、R等。这些技术和工具可以帮助分析师高效地处理和分析大规模数据,提高数据分析的效率和准确性。
总的来说,进行大数据分析需要具备数据处理与清洗、数据挖掘与统计分析、机器学习与人工智能、数据可视化与报告、大数据技术与工具等多方面的知识和技能。只有全面掌握这些知识,才能在大数据分析领域取得更好的成果。
1年前 -
-
大数据分析是一种利用大数据技术和工具对海量数据进行分析和挖掘的过程,以发现潜在的模式、关联和趋势,从而为决策提供支持和指导。要进行有效的大数据分析,需要具备以下几方面的知识:
一、数据处理与存储技术:包括数据采集、数据清洗、数据存储和数据管理等技术。数据采集是指从各种数据源中获取数据,数据清洗是指对数据进行预处理,去除错误数据和噪声数据,数据存储是指选择合适的存储方式来存储大数据,数据管理则是指对数据进行管理和维护。
二、数据挖掘与机器学习:数据挖掘是指从大数据中发现隐藏在其中的模式、关联和趋势的过程,而机器学习则是通过训练算法来实现数据挖掘的过程。掌握数据挖掘和机器学习算法对于大数据分析至关重要,例如聚类、分类、回归、关联规则挖掘等算法。
三、统计分析与数据可视化:统计分析是大数据分析的基础,通过统计方法对数据进行分析和解释,从而得出结论和预测。数据可视化则是将分析结果以图表、图形等形式展示出来,帮助用户更直观地理解数据。
四、数据库管理系统:掌握数据库管理系统是进行大数据分析的基本要求,需要熟悉关系型数据库和非关系型数据库的原理和操作,能够进行数据的查询、更新、删除等操作。
五、编程技能:大数据分析通常需要使用编程语言进行数据处理和分析,如Python、R、Java等。掌握至少一种编程语言,并熟练运用相关的数据处理和分析库是进行大数据分析的必备技能。
六、领域知识:针对不同的领域和行业,需要了解相关的领域知识,以更好地理解和分析数据,提出有效的解决方案。
综上所述,要进行有效的大数据分析,需要掌握数据处理与存储技术、数据挖掘与机器学习、统计分析与数据可视化、数据库管理系统、编程技能和领域知识等方面的知识。只有综合运用这些知识,才能对海量数据进行深入分析,挖掘出有价值的信息和见解。
1年前 -
标题:大数据分析所需知识概述
在进行大数据分析时,需要掌握以下几方面的知识:
-
数据处理与清洗
- 数据采集:了解不同数据源的获取方式,如数据库、API、日志文件等。
- 数据清洗:掌握数据清洗的方法,包括去重、填充缺失值、处理异常值等。
- 数据转换:熟悉数据转换的技术,如数据格式转换、数据标准化、数据归一化等。
-
数据存储与管理
- 数据库知识:了解常见的数据库类型(关系型数据库、NoSQL数据库)以及它们的特点和适用场景。
- 数据仓库:掌握数据仓库的概念和设计原则,了解数据仓库的建模方法和工具。
-
数据分析与挖掘
- 统计学知识:具备统计学基础知识,包括描述统计、推断统计、概率等。
- 机器学习算法:了解常见的机器学习算法原理和应用场景,如回归分析、分类算法、聚类算法等。
- 数据可视化:熟练使用数据可视化工具,能够将分析结果以图表形式展示,提高数据分析的可解释性。
-
编程与工具
- 编程语言:掌握至少一种数据分析常用编程语言,如Python、R等。
- 数据分析工具:熟练使用数据分析工具,如Pandas、NumPy、Scikit-learn等。
-
领域知识
- 需要了解所在行业的领域知识,能够将数据分析结果与业务场景结合,为决策提供支持。
总之,大数据分析需要综合运用数据处理、数据存储、数据分析与挖掘、编程与工具等多方面的知识,以及对具体领域的了解,才能更好地进行有效的数据分析工作。
1年前 -


